Inquiry Stage:
- Evaluate force transducer measurement requirements
- Evaluate customer requirements; inspection, test, quality, witnessing and schedule
- Review similar applications, special tools needed, vendor and subcontractor capabilities
This stage entails the customer providing the specifications and
requirements to Strainsert and us to evaluate the needs of the customer and
plan the series of steps necessary to address those needs best.
Quotation Stage:
- Engineering estimates for materials, tooling and time
- Sales incorporates in-house estimates, vendor/sub-contractor support and in-house commitments
- Generate quotations, pricing and delivery, notations and exceptions
This stage entails Strainsert identifying the scope and cost quotations for
the custom design and development of the particular application.
Preliminary Design Stage:
- Material Definition
- Environmental Specifications
- Stress Analysis
- Measurement and Calibration Definition
- Bridge Configuration
- Cabling/Clearance
- Customer Meetings
This stage entails Strainsert’s preliminary assessment of the application design
and coordination of feedback from the customer.
Customer Review Stage:
- Provide drawing package to customer
- Physical geometry and characteristics
- Measurement criteria and specifications
- Strength, material and finish data
- Clarify and finalize every requirement
- Receive final approved design/drawings from customer
This stage entails the customer review of the preliminary design drawings and specifications
with a clear final approval process.
Detailed Design Stage:
- Develop detailed part/component manufacturing drawings
- Generate strain gage/wiring schematics
- Develop all assembly and sub-assembly drawings
- Cabling and Clearance
- Define all required bill of materials
- Document detailed manufacturing instructions
- Document required calibration and instrumentation
- Detail special testing/hold points, special processing
This stage entails taking the preliminary design that has been approved by the
customer and incorporating the detailed data necessary to initiate manufacturing
the application.
Material Procurement Stage:
- Bill of material drives raw material and component procurement
- Utilize approved suppliers for required materials and special processes
- Maintain certifications for all major components
- Recieve and inspect materials and certifications
This stage entails Strainsert procuring materials necessary to develop and
manufacture, activate suppliers and certify components.
Manufacture and Testing Stage:
- Transducer Build
- Manufacture and route per documented custom instructions
- Complete all required in-house testing, quality information and vendor support
- Transducer Testing
- Perform final deliverable testing and deliverable quality information
- Review and sign-off deliverable component and system testing including all quality deliverables
This stage entails the manufacture, testing and operation of the custom transducer.
Customer Delivery Stage:
- Final transducer and system health check
- Vibration Test
- Bridge Resistance
- Shunt Reading
- Insulation Resistance
- Zero Balance
- Provide equipment, test fixtures, instrumentation and deliverable reports
- Continuing communication and support as required
This stage entails Strainsert delivering the finished product to the customer
for installation and maintaining the relationship for continuing support as required.
